Salary Guide for Faculty in Lamia

📊 Faculty salaries in Lamia, as per 2025 data, range from €25,000 for entry-level lecturers to €55,000 for senior professors, influenced by experience, institution, and national adjustments. In Greece, academic pay includes base salary plus allowances for research and teaching. For example, an Assistant Professor earns €30,000-€40,000 annually, while Associate Professors average €45,000, and Full Professors €50,000+. Cost of living in Lamia is low, with housing at €500/month, making these salaries competitive compared to Athens.

Factors affecting pay include EU grants, which can add €5,000-€10,000 for research-active faculty. Public institutions like University of Thessaly offer stable benefits, including pensions. Compared to EU averages, Lamia's salaries are modest but supported by low taxes and living costs. For detailed salaries Lamia academia, check AcademicJobs.com.

Entry-level roles like Postdocs start at €25,000, rising with publications. Private sector collaborations can boost income. Overall, Lamia's salary structure supports a comfortable lifestyle, with opportunities for supplements through consulting.

In health sciences, specialized professors earn higher, up to €60,000 with experience. National trends show slight increases due to inflation adjustments. Academics benefit from 13th-month pay in Greece.

To maximize earnings, focus on tenure and grants. Lamia's affordable environment stretches salaries further than in major cities.

Weather and Climate in Lamia

☀️ Lamia's Mediterranean climate features hot, dry summers (average 30°C in July) and mild, wet winters (10°C in January), with annual rainfall around 600mm. This weather supports year-round outdoor activities, ideal for academics enjoying campus walks or nearby mountains. Summers can be hot, impacting indoor work, but mild winters allow for consistent research schedules. Data from 2025 forecasts show stable patterns, with occasional heatwaves; newcomers should prepare for sunny days, averaging 2,800 hours of sunshine yearly.

Seasonal variations include blooming springs perfect for conferences and autumns for focused teaching. Weather influences academic life by enabling outdoor events, though rain in winter may affect commuting. Tips: Visit in spring for mild temps; use air-conditioned facilities in summer.

Lifestyle and Cost of Living in Lamia

Lifestyle in Lamia combines affordability with cultural richness, with cost of living 30% lower than Athens. 📍 Average rent is €400-€600/month, groceries €200/month, making it ideal for academics. Transportation is efficient via buses, with cultural attractions like ancient ruins and festivals enriching daily life.

Dining options feature Greek cuisine at low costs, and recreation includes hiking in nearby mountains. Compared to national averages, Lamia offers value, supporting family-oriented lifestyles.
